THE BLOOD
  1. Immune response
    1. Antigens are sites on the surface of cells allowing it to be recognised by WBC's
      1. WBC's release antibodies
        1. antibodies work like enzymes ( Lock & Key)
          1. Causes problems with donor organs as WBC's may attack and slowly destroy it
        2. Composition of Blood
          1. Plasma
            1. Transports materials around the body
            2. Platelets
              1. Clot blood
                1. Clotting Process
                  1. Blood is exposed to air
                    1. Platelets breakdown & fibrin is formed
                      1. The fibrin forms a mesh which hardens forming a clot
                2. White blood cells
                  1. Used during Phagocytosis
                    1. Process of Phagocytosis
                      1. The WBC approaches the bacterium
                        1. it then engulfes thr bacterium
                          1. The DNA codes for digestive enzymes
                            1. The enzymes are released and destroy the bacterium
                    2. Red blood cells
                      1. carry oxygen
                        1. biconcave cells containing no nucleus
                          1. Contain haemoglobin
